Emergency Situations
What should I do if a tree has fallen on my house, car, or power lines?
Evacuate the area immediately and call 911 if anyone is injured or if power lines are involved. Do not touch the tree or downed wires. Call us at (504) 788-8733. We prioritize these emergencies, and will dispatch a crew as soon as possible to assess the situation, coordinate with utility companies, and prevent further damage.
What should I do if a tree is splitting or leaning dangerously?
Stay at least 2x the height of the tree away from the tree if able to and keep pets/children indoors. Do not attempt to brace or cut it yourself—sudden collapses are common. Call us immediately for emergency stabilization or removal.
What should I do if a tree is on fire after a lightning strike?
Call 911 first. Avoid using garden hoses to put out the fire. Once firefighters extinguish the flames, we work directly with the fire department to safely remove burned trees and assess nearby trees for hidden damage.
What should I do if a tree uproots but remains partially standing?
Treat it as an active hazard—uprooted trees can rebound or collapse without warning. Avoid the yard entirely until we arrive. We will stabilize the tree then safely dismantle the tree in sections, minimizing risk to your property.
What should I do if a tree is dropping large limbs without warning?
Stay indoors and avoid the area. Call us for a hazard assessment—we’ll identify the cause and remove unstable limbs, hanging deadwood or, ultimately, recommend a full tree removal.

What is ArborMaster® training?
ArborMaster® is a globally recognized certification program for advanced tree care. It focuses on technical climbing, rigging, and hazardous tree removal techniques to ensure safety and precision in complex jobs.
What is TCIA (Tree Care Industry Association)?
TCIA is a trade association that sets the standards for tree care in the United States for business, safety, sales and regulatory compliance.
What is ISA Certification?
ISA Certification validates expertise in tree biology, health, and property tree care practices. Certified arborists must pass rigorous exams and adhere to industry best practices for tree care and preservation.

What is the best time of year to trim trees?
Late winter (January–February) is ideal for most species, as trees are dormant and pests are less active. For hurricane-prone areas like New Orleans, schedule preventive pruning by May. Palms and oaks have species-specific timing—we’ll advise during your assessment.
Can you help prepare in advance for a hurricane or storm?
Yes. We offer storm-prep packages: crown thinning, deadwood removal, and pruning high-risk trees. We make sure branches are clear of windows, roofs and other buildings on the property. These services reduce damage that a powerful storm can cause.
